We are very excited to announce that Solatube is scheduled to air on the DIY Network's "Bathroom Renovations." The episode (DBTR-411) will premiere on Tuesday, February 13 at 6 p.m. PST and will feature the installation of a Solatube tubular skylight (the episode was filmed prior to the release of the new product). In a three-part renovation entitled "Victorian Expansion," an old turn-of-the-century Victorian home in St. Paul, Minn. is renovated to include a Solatube tubular skylight over the shower and tub area, installed by Host Amy Matthews. (The bathroom is also renovated to extend into the existing laundry room and includes a fireplace!)
Although the installation will be featured in the first episode of the renovation, the Solatube should also be seen in "Victorian Expansion" episodes DBTR-412 (premiering Feb. 13 at 6:30 PST) and DBTR-413 (premiering Tues., Feb. 20 at 6 p.m. PST).
We are pleased to announce that Solar Star® will be featured nationally on "Ask This Old House" on PBS during the week of February 15 (Episode #520). Air dates and times will vary by market. The sister-show of the extremely well-known "This Old House," "Ask This Old House" helps solve homeowners' home improvement problems. In this episode, host Tom Silva installs two Solar Star fans in a Massachusetts home. (The producer has told us that the Solar Star units "worked perfectly for us. We were quite impressed with the quality of the units!")
